Korean Body Proportion Standards Explained

Body proportion standards in Korea are heavily influenced by fashion, entertainment culture, photography, and modern beauty trends. In Seoul—especially in Gangnam—body contouring procedures are often planned around achieving visual balance and smooth silhouette lines rather than simply reducing body size. Korean beauty culture generally places strong emphasis on harmony between the waist, shoulders, hips, legs, and facial proportions to create an overall refined appearance.

Why Proportion Matters More Than Weight

In Korean aesthetics, body shape is often considered more important than the number on a scale.

Common priorities include:

  • Balanced shoulder-to-waist ratio
  • Slim but natural leg lines
  • Smooth waist-to-hip transitions
  • Long-looking body proportions
  • Overall silhouette harmony

Because of this, many patients seek contour refinement rather than major weight loss.

The “Balanced Silhouette” Ideal

Korean beauty standards usually favor soft, proportional body lines instead of exaggerated curves.

Typical characteristics:

  • Slim waist without extreme definition
  • Lean arms and thighs
  • Natural hip curves
  • Smooth contour transitions between body areas
  • Elegant and lightweight overall appearance

The goal is often a clean and polished silhouette that looks natural in everyday clothing.

Influence of K-Pop and Korean Fashion

Celebrity culture strongly shapes body proportion preferences in Korea.

Major influences include:

  • Stage fashion worn by idols
  • Tailored clothing styles
  • High-waisted fashion trends
  • Slim silhouettes emphasized in media and photography
  • Airport fashion and social media styling

These visual trends create strong demand for subtle contour refinement procedures.

Popular Proportion Goals in Korea

Many patients request procedures designed around improving overall balance.

Common goals:

  • Smaller-looking waistline
  • Slimmer thigh and calf transitions
  • Defined but soft jawline
  • Balanced upper and lower body proportions
  • Longer-looking leg silhouette

The emphasis is usually on refinement rather than dramatic transformation.

How Korean Clinics Plan Body Contouring

Gangnam clinics often approach body contouring with detailed aesthetic mapping.

Common planning factors:

  • Height and frame proportions
  • Fat distribution patterns
  • Hip-to-waist balance
  • Shoulder width relative to waist
  • Leg shape and lower body flow

Procedures are often customized to improve the appearance of proportion rather than targeting only one isolated area.

The Difference Between Korean and Western Standards

There are noticeable differences between Korean and some Western beauty preferences.

Korean trends often emphasize:

  • Slim and refined proportions
  • Softer curves
  • Natural contour transitions
  • Lean silhouette appearance

Some Western trends may prioritize:

  • Stronger athletic definition
  • More dramatic curves
  • Larger muscle emphasis
  • Sharper contour contrast

Neither approach is “better,” but the aesthetic priorities are different.

Facial and Body Balance Connection

In Korea, body proportions are often considered together with facial proportions.

Common aesthetic concepts:

  • Small face appearance relative to body
  • Long neck and jawline balance
  • Slim shoulder and upper body proportions
  • Harmony between facial contour and body silhouette

This integrated beauty approach strongly influences cosmetic procedure planning.

Social Media and Camera-Focused Beauty

Modern Korean beauty standards are also influenced by photography and video culture.

Visual priorities often include:

  • Silhouette appearance in fitted clothing
  • Balanced proportions in photos
  • Smooth body lines from multiple angles
  • Slim profile and side-line appearance

This has increased interest in 360-degree contouring approaches.

Final Thoughts

Korean body proportion standards focus on harmony, balance, and refined silhouette design rather than extreme transformation or aggressive definition. Influenced by K-pop culture, fashion trends, and media aesthetics, many patients seek subtle contour improvements that create smoother and more proportional body lines. In Gangnam clinics, body contouring is often approached as a full-body design process aimed at enhancing overall balance while maintaining natural-looking results.
